The SARS-CoV-2 pandemic saw a high death toll which was reduced as drugs such as Remdesivir were introduced as treatments. This process was slow and few drugs were found capable of reducing the mortality of the virus. A solution to this issue is presented: finding existing, workable treatments using batch active learning.
